Research with "possible" and "impossible" events has led to the conclusion that infants
A. are born with object permanence.
B. develop an understanding of object permanence at a younger age than was predicted by Piaget.
C. develop an understanding of object permanence at the exact age that was predicted by Piaget.
D. develop an understanding of object permanence at an older age than was predicted by Piaget.
Answer: B
